vgritsenko 2004/01/16 05:38:33
Modified: . xindice.bat xindice.sh
Log:
Fix discrepancy in comments and code (JAVA_OPTIONS vs JAVA_OPT)
Revision Changes Path
1.13 +18 -4 xml-xindice/xindice.bat
Index: xindice.bat
===================================================================
RCS file: /home/cvs/xml-xindice/xindice.bat,v
retrieving revision 1.12
retrieving revision 1.13
diff -u -r1.12 -r1.13
--- xindice.bat 14 Jan 2004 14:06:09 -0000 1.12
+++ xindice.bat 16 Jan 2004 13:38:33 -0000 1.13
@@ -6,6 +6,20 @@
:: $Id$
::
-----------------------------------------------------------------------------
+:: Configuration variables
+::
+:: XINDICE_HOME
+:: Home of Xindice program and data.
+::
+:: JAVA_HOME
+:: Home of Java installation.
+::
+:: JAVA_OPTIONS
+:: Extra options to pass to the JVM
+::
+:: JETTY_PORT
+:: Override the default port for Jetty
+
:: ----- Verify and Set Required Environment Variables
-------------------------
if not "%JAVA_HOME%" == "" goto gotJavaHome
@@ -75,19 +89,19 @@
:: ----- Start Servlet
---------------------------------------------------------
:doStart
-%EXEC% %JAVA_HOME%\bin\java.exe %JAVA_OPT% -classpath %LOCALCLASSPATH%
-Djava.endorsed.dirs=build\endorsed -Dxindice.home="%XINDICE_HOME%"
-Dxindice.db.home="%XINDICE_HOME%" -Dwebapp=%JETTY_WEBAPP%
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=%JETTY_PORT% -Djetty.admin.port=%JETTY_ADMIN_PORT%
org.mortbay.jetty.Server tools\jetty\conf\main.xml
+%EXEC% %JAVA_HOME%\bin\java.exe %JAVA_OPTIONS% -classpath %LOCALCLASSPATH%
-Djava.endorsed.dirs=build\endorsed -Dxindice.home="%XINDICE_HOME%"
-Dxindice.db.home="%XINDICE_HOME%" -Dwebapp=%JETTY_WEBAPP%
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=%JETTY_PORT% -Djetty.admin.port=%JETTY_ADMIN_PORT%
org.mortbay.jetty.Server tools\jetty\conf\main.xml
goto end
:: ----- Run Servlet
-----------------------------------------------------------
:doRun
-%JAVA_HOME%\bin\java.exe %JAVA_OPT% -classpath %LOCALCLASSPATH%
-Djava.endorsed.dirs=build\endorsed -Dxindice.home="%XINDICE_HOME%"
-Dxindice.db.home="%XINDICE_HOME%" -Dwebapp=%JETTY_WEBAPP%
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=%JETTY_PORT% -Djetty.admin.port=%JETTY_ADMIN_PORT%
org.mortbay.jetty.Server tools\jetty\conf\main.xml
+%JAVA_HOME%\bin\java.exe %JAVA_OPTIONS% -classpath %LOCALCLASSPATH%
-Djava.endorsed.dirs=build\endorsed -Dxindice.home="%XINDICE_HOME%"
-Dxindice.db.home="%XINDICE_HOME%" -Dwebapp=%JETTY_WEBAPP%
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=%JETTY_PORT% -Djetty.admin.port=%JETTY_ADMIN_PORT%
org.mortbay.jetty.Server tools\jetty\conf\main.xml
goto end
:: ----- Servlet Debug
---------------------------------------------------------
:doDebug
-%EXEC% %JAVA_HOME%\bin\java.exe %JAVA_OPT% -Xdebug
-Xrunjdwp:transport=dt_socket,address=%JAVA_DEBUG_PORT%,server=y,suspend=n
-classpath %LOCALCLASSPATH%
-Dorg.apache.commons.logging.Log=org.apache.commons.logging.impl.SimpleLog
-Dorg.apache.commons.logging.simplelog.defaultlog=debug
-Djava.endorsed.dirs=build\endorsed -Dxindice.home="%XINDICE_HOME%"
-Dxindice.db.home="%XINDICE_HOME%" -Dwebapp=%JETTY_WEBAPP%
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=%JETTY_PORT% -Djetty.admin.port=%JETTY_ADMIN_PORT%
org.mortbay.jetty.Server tools\jetty\conf\main.xml tools\jetty\conf\admin.xml
+%EXEC% %JAVA_HOME%\bin\java.exe %JAVA_OPTIONS% -Xdebug
-Xrunjdwp:transport=dt_socket,address=%JAVA_DEBUG_PORT%,server=y,suspend=n
-classpath %LOCALCLASSPATH%
-Dorg.apache.commons.logging.Log=org.apache.commons.logging.impl.SimpleLog
-Dorg.apache.commons.logging.simplelog.defaultlog=debug
-Djava.endorsed.dirs=build\endorsed -Dxindice.home="%XINDICE_HOME%"
-Dxindice.db.home="%XINDICE_HOME%" -Dwebapp=%JETTY_WEBAPP%
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=%JETTY_PORT% -Djetty.admin.port=%JETTY_ADMIN_PORT%
org.mortbay.jetty.Server tools\jetty\conf\main.xml tools\jetty\conf\admin.xml
goto end
1.10 +8 -4 xml-xindice/xindice.sh
Index: xindice.sh
===================================================================
RCS file: /home/cvs/xml-xindice/xindice.sh,v
retrieving revision 1.9
retrieving revision 1.10
diff -u -r1.9 -r1.10
--- xindice.sh 1 Jan 2004 21:46:41 -0000 1.9
+++ xindice.sh 16 Jan 2004 13:38:33 -0000 1.10
@@ -37,6 +37,7 @@
# ----- OS specific support
----------------------------------------------------
+
cygwin=false;
darwin=false;
case "`uname`" in
@@ -50,6 +51,7 @@
# ----- Verify and Set Required Environment Variables
-------------------------
+
if [ "$JAVA_HOME" = "" ] ; then
echo You must set JAVA_HOME to point at your Java Development Kit
installation
exit 1
@@ -58,7 +60,7 @@
if [ "$XINDICE_HOME" = "" ] ; then
echo
echo "WARNING: The environment variable XINDICE_HOME is not set."
- echo " defaulting to `pwd`."
+ echo " Defaulting to `pwd`"
XINDICE_HOME=`pwd`
fi
@@ -91,11 +93,13 @@
# ----- Set Classpath
----------------------------------------------------------
+
for i in `ls $XINDICE_HOME/java/lib/*.jar` ; do CP=$CP:$i ; done
for i in `ls $XINDICE_HOME/tools/jetty/lib/*.jar` ; do CP=$CP:$i ; done
# ----- Do the action
----------------------------------------------------------
+
JAVACMD=$JAVA_HOME/bin/java
JETTY_CONFIG="$XINDICE_HOME/tools/jetty/conf/main.xml"
# For Cygwin, switch paths to Windows format before running java
@@ -123,14 +127,14 @@
echo "Starting Xindice - Log files are under $XINDICE_HOME/logs"
echo
- nohup sh -c "$JAVA_HOME/bin/java $JAVA_OPT -classpath \"$CP\"
-Djava.endorsed.dirs=build/endorsed -Dxindice.home=\"$XINDICE_HOME\"
-Dxindice.db.home=\"$XINDICE_HOME\" -Dwebapp=\"$JETTY_WEBAPP\"
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=$JETTY_PORT -Djetty.admin.port=$JETTY_ADMIN_PORT
org.mortbay.jetty.Server \"$JETTY_CONFIG\"" >> $XINDICE_HOME/logs/xindice.out
2>&1 &
+ nohup sh -c "$JAVA_HOME/bin/java $JAVA_OPTIONS -classpath \"$CP\"
-Djava.endorsed.dirs=build/endorsed -Dxindice.home=\"$XINDICE_HOME\"
-Dxindice.db.home=\"$XINDICE_HOME\" -Dwebapp=\"$JETTY_WEBAPP\"
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=$JETTY_PORT -Djetty.admin.port=$JETTY_ADMIN_PORT
org.mortbay.jetty.Server \"$JETTY_CONFIG\"" >> $XINDICE_HOME/logs/xindice.out
2>&1 &
echo $! > $XINDICE_PID
echo "Xindice is running with PID `cat $XINDICE_PID`"
;;
debug)
- $JAVACMD $JAVA_OPT -Xdebug
-Xrunjdwp:transport=dt_socket,address=$JAVA_DEBUG_PORT,server=y,suspend=n
-classpath "$CP" -Djava.endorsed.dirs=build/endorsed
-Dxindice.home="$XINDICE_HOME" -Dxindice.db.home="$XINDICE_HOME"
-Dwebapp="$JETTY_WEBAPP"
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=$JETTY_PORT -Djetty.admin.port=$JETTY_ADMIN_PORT
org.mortbay.jetty.Server "$JETTY_CONFIG"
"$XINDICE_HOME/tools/jetty/conf/admin.xml" >> $XINDICE_HOME/logs/xindice.out
2>&1
+ $JAVACMD $JAVA_OPTIONS -Xdebug
-Xrunjdwp:transport=dt_socket,address=$JAVA_DEBUG_PORT,server=y,suspend=n
-classpath "$CP" -Djava.endorsed.dirs=build/endorsed
-Dxindice.home="$XINDICE_HOME" -Dxindice.db.home="$XINDICE_HOME"
-Dwebapp="$JETTY_WEBAPP"
-Dorg.xml.sax.parser=org.apache.xerces.parsers.SAXParser
-Djetty.port=$JETTY_PORT -Djetty.admin.port=$JETTY_ADMIN_PORT
org.mortbay.jetty.Server "$JETTY_CONFIG"
"$XINDICE_HOME/tools/jetty/conf/admin.xml" >> $XINDICE_HOME/logs/xindice.out
2>&1
;;
stop)